Source: Zaporizhia Regional State Administration

A two-day training on “Project Writing and the State Fund for Regional Development” started in RSA as part of the international technical aid project “Partnership for Local Economic Development” (PLEDDG). The event welcomed the representatives of RSAs, Municipal Executive Committees, and heads of the RSA structural units and amalgamated territorial communities engaged in direct coordination of the work and development of the projects eligible for being implemented at the costs of the State Fund for Regional Development.

Zinaida Boyko, Chief of RSA’s staff, reminded that the State Fund for Regional Development has been operating in Ukraine since 2012. Today it serves as a powerful driving force for development of regions and acts as a catalyst for upturn of investment activity and inflow of private investments in territorial communities’ development. Its funds are to be directed to financing of the projects having crucial value for the development of regions.

The experience obtained over the last years shows local specialists’ downplaying the detailed work namely on development of the projects able to promote economic growth of the territory.

The international technical assistance project “Partnership for Local Economic Development and Democratic Governance” (PLEDDG) calls for training for the communities of the region to generate high quality and effective projects specifically dedicated to regional development. PLEDDG Project is being implemented by the Federation of Canadian Municipalities (FCM) and funded by Global Affairs Canada. It is the third year in a row already that the Project’s experts have delivered trainings on preparation of the projects to become eligible for SFRD funding.

– This year, the state budget of SFRD allocates funds in the amount of 6 billion UAH, with 195.3 million UAH allocated for Zaporizhia region. The resources of the fund serve as a significant source for implementation of the projects of public interest for the region. That being said, the legislation governing the issue of the State Fund of Regional Development has undergone amendments. As per 2017, no less than 10% of the Fund’s resources shall be targeted to each of the following areas: sport infrastructure development; development of energy efficiency of education and health care institutions, — said Zinaida Boyko.

As part of the training, the Project’s expert Vasyl Kashevskyy dwelled on the question of the pillars of state fund for regional development operation in detail and gave practical advice on project preparation.

The expert also assured that the participants were able to put both their knowledge of key changes in legal framework and practical advice on the project preparation details in practice in the near future.

It is expected that in April, pre-qualification of investment programs and regional development projects eligible to obtain SFRD funding for the year of 2019 will be announced.
